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by SirThornberry,
30. Okt 2008
Ich habe dich verstanden. Das Zauberwort lautet Owner :-D Beim instanzieren einer Komponente (.Create) übergibst du Create einen Owner. Und auf diesen kommt es an. Wenn du zum Beispiel ein Panel mit Buttons hast und willst das diese mit auftauchen dann muss es so aussehen:
constructor TYourSuperPanel.Create(AOwner: TComponent);
begin
inherited Create(AOwner);
fButton :=...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by SirThornberry,
25. Okt 2008
Könntest du bitte das Bild dem Beitrag anhängen damit der Beitrag seine Bedeutung nicht verliert wenn du das Bild irgendwann wieder von dem externen Webspace löschst. :-)
Das was du da bei TTabSheet siehst ist eigentlich recht einfach. Und zwar wird einfach nur ein TTabSheet erzeugt welches als Parent das TPageControl zugwiesen bekommt. So als würde man ein Panel auf das Form packen und darauf...